blackpool wrote:
Whys nobody asking the most important question How much do you pay ?

£50/month for supersides
£75/months for full wrap
Minimum campaign is 3 months.

Lichfield do not allow any signs other than Lichfield PH signs or very limited company sign (i.e. my name/phone number) which is annoying as Lichfield is 13 miles away while Tamworth allow adverts and im only 8 mile away from there....
